A Blender render farm is a group of computers that renders one project by assigning different animation frames to separate workers, called nodes. A 100-frame animation at five minutes per frame takes 8 hours and 20 minutes on one computer. A farm renders many frames at once.

## How a render farm splits an animation

Each animation frame is an independent image, so a node can start frame 42 before another node finishes frame 41. More nodes reduce the wait until only the final group of frames remains.

Simulations and temporal effects are the main exception. Bake cloth, fluids, particles, Geometry Nodes simulations, and other sequential caches before submission so every node reads the same state.

## What every render node needs

A `.blend` file stores scene data, but it can reference textures, HDRIs, linked libraries, fonts, video, and caches elsewhere. A farm must receive those files with the project or Blender can produce missing textures, static simulations, or incomplete frames.

Each node also needs the correct Blender version, render engine, add-ons, output format, and scene settings. See [Blender project dependencies](/dependencies), [render engine compatibility](/compatibility/render-engines), and [add-on support](/addons).

One frame must fit on one node. Adding nodes gives the animation more GPU memory in total, but it does not combine that memory for a single frame. Large geometry, textures, and volumes can still exceed one node's memory.

## Cycles and EEVEE create different farm workloads

[Cycles](/cycles-render-farm) often spends minutes tracing each frame, so parallel rendering can remove a large part of the wait. [EEVEE](/eevee-render-farm) can finish frames much faster, which makes startup and file transfer a larger share of the job.

The useful node count therefore depends on the scene, frame count, and frame-time spread. A test job gives you a better estimate than the local time for one convenient frame.

## Why submit from Blender

Submitting from Blender lets the Superluminal add-on inspect the project you already have open. It checks file references before upload and names missing files, unreadable files, absolute paths, and files on another drive.

The add-on packages the project and sends the job. No settings rebuilt in a separate uploader. You keep working in Blender, follow submission progress, and download original outputs as frames finish.

## Measured render time and cost

Our [2026 Blender render farm benchmark](/compare/blender-render-farms) recorded 43 runs across nine services and four scenes. Superluminal delivered the complete local output first and recorded the shortest render pipeline in all four scenes.

The render pipeline is the benchmark's clock for the farm itself. It runs from the moment a service starts working on the job until the service reports the render finished, so it includes analysis, queueing, startup, and retries, not just rendering. The 12 Superluminal jobs cost from $0.14 to $1.90, or $9.56 combined. All 12 together cost less than one competitor's displayed quote for a single scene.

## Finished frames should arrive during the render

The job page shows completed frames, render layers, timing, and logs. The Blender add-on can download original files while other nodes continue to render, so review and compositing can start before the full sequence ends.
